Contact Centre Agent

3 months ago


London, Greater London, United Kingdom Angle House Orthodontics Full time

Contact Centre Agent / Switchboard - Angle House Enfield (EN2 8PD)**Are your ears ringing? Can you provide a prompt and efficient, first-class response? Engaging with the caller by using a smile is essential.

Angle House Orthodontics is looking for outgoing, hard-working and passionate individuals to join our great Contact Centre team

This role is full-time, 40 hours a week, Monday to Friday only

Why work with us?

  • Private medical cover (after 1 year of service)
  • Great working environment
  • Friendly and supportive team
  • Training and development opportunities (paid membership with Isopharm and Angle House Education)
  • Enhanced pension scheme (after 2 years of service)
  • Social events (online at present)
  • Worklife balance
  • Competitive salary

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provides courteous service to patients by following our policies and procedures as well as completing the Call Agent's task list to the highest standard
  • Responds to patients requests for information about our practices and treatments we offer
  • Arranges patients' bookings, rebookings and cancellations
  • Transfers incoming calls promptly to the appropriate extension

Requirements:

  • Excellent team player with strong communication skills, you will have a passion for delivering a great patient experience
  • Fantastic patient care skills are essential
  • Great IT skills and ability to learn new computer systems fast
  • Ability to perform under pressure and multitask
  • Professional approach when dealing with sensitive and confidential information
  • Previous experience of using a patient booking system is advantageous

About us:

Established in 1988, Angle House has several multi-disciplinary specialist dental practices across London. In each practice, a team of expert orthodontic professionals work together to provide excellent orthodontic care for our patients.

We are passionate about what we do and want our patients to experience a courteous, caring, friendly and safe environment where patients' smiles and dental health are our priority.

If you are a passionate people person and a multi-tasker who is solution-focused, then we want to hear from you

Job Types:
Full-time, Permanent

Salary:
£24,856.00 per year
